North entrance of the Main Building on campus Dickinson Building Keats Science Building. PVCC's main campus is 501 College Drive in Charlottesville, Virginia. It consists of the Main Building, the V. Earl Dickinson Building for Humanities and Social Sciences, the Keats Science Building, and the Stultz Center for Business and Career Development.
The PVCC Center for the Performing Arts, containing stage facilities for drama and music performances, opened in 2005. In 2007 the L-Building was built to house classes for Nursing, Fire Science and EMT. The building was built using a modular construction system. [4] In 2007 PVCC acquired the adjacent George L. Campbell Branch Library.
